A VDR platform can be extremely beneficial in any situation where an internal company needs to share confidential documents with investors, service providers or other external parties. VDRs are useful for executives at the top trying to negotiate a deal or HR teams that need to keep track of employee records, and project managers who must facilitate the sharing of documents for various initiatives.
There are many different types of VDRs available on the market and locating one that’s right for a particular company may be difficult. When looking at VDR providers, it is important to focus on the cost of vdr the essential aspects like security measures, user experience, and pricing structure. It is crucial to select a trusted provider for companies who will be confiding the platform with sensitive data and documents.
It is also important to make sure that the VDR platform has mobile support to ensure that all parties are able to access information on any device. It’s a good idea to test the mobile app and desktop application before finalizing your purchase.
Choose a platform that offers granular settings. You can set who is able to download, view or print documents. You may also be looking for a service provider that provides redaction, multi-factor authentication, and watermarking.
You should read unbiased reviews on websites like Capterra and G2 before making a decision. It’s best to choose the service provider that focuses on user-friendliness and ease of use. This can speed up the due diligence process and improve overall productivity. It is also recommended to check the provider’s website for information regarding pricing, data usage limits, and security standards.
